Monochromebooks.com: A Novel Approach to Reading

Monochromebooks.com aims to revolutionize the publishing industry by offering books printed entirely on black paper with white text.

This unique aesthetic is presented not just as a design choice but as a functional enhancement, claiming to offer an “easier, more enjoyable, and more beautiful reading experience.” The company emphasizes traditional craftsmanship combined with modern technology, creating what they describe as collectible, limited-edition hardcover and hand-bound luxury editions.

Their mission is to “reinvent the pleasure of reading” by focusing on the visual and tactile aspects of books, transforming them into objects of art and design.

This approach targets readers who appreciate unique physical books and may be looking for an alternative to conventional white-page formats.

The Vision Behind Black Paper Books

Monochromebooks.com Alternatives

For those interested in unique book editions, high-quality printing, or alternative reading experiences, several options exist beyond Monochromebooks.com.

  • Fine Press Publishers:
    • The Folio Society: Known for beautifully illustrated and bound editions of classic and modern literature. They use high-quality paper, bindings, and often include bespoke slipcases, appealing to collectors who prioritize aesthetic and tactile qualities.
    • Easton Press: Offers heirloom-quality leather-bound editions of classic books, often with gilded edges and intricate designs. Their focus is on creating durable, luxurious editions.
  • Independent Publishers and Artists: Many smaller presses and individual book artists create unique, hand-bound, or limited-edition books with unconventional designs, custom artwork, or experimental printing techniques. These can be found on platforms like Etsy, specialized book arts fairs, or independent bookstore websites.
  • Digital Dark Mode: For readers who enjoy white text on a black background for readability, e-readers and tablets universally offer a “dark mode” or “night mode” setting. This provides the same visual contrast without the physical medium constraints. Kindle, Kobo, and various reading apps all support this feature.
  • Used and Antiquarian Bookstores: For those seeking unique, historically significant, or aesthetically distinctive physical books, exploring used, rare, and antiquarian bookstores can yield fascinating finds, often with unique bindings, illustrations, or historical context. Websites like AbeBooks and Biblio are excellent online resources.
  • Crowdfunding Platforms for Books: Platforms like Kickstarter and Indiegogo frequently feature campaigns for new and innovative book projects, often with unique designs, custom artwork, or specialized printing. This allows readers to support and discover new, unconventional literary works directly.
